When I do an overhang test, I always have this problem at about 35°. Does anyone have a suggestion what could be causing it? * Slicer: Orca * Layer height: 0.2mm * Infill: 0% (this has improved it a lot, I think the infill was causing bulging) * Outer walls: 2 * Overhang speed: 10 or 20mm/s (both look the same) ![](https://lemmy.world/pictrs/image/677fb0bd-6323-4acf-b822-8f0919380954.jpeg) ![](https://lemmy.world/pictrs/image/a62ccd1e-841d-4136-b435-0e8d15f5018a.jpeg) **Solution:** I mistakenly thought overhang speed in Orca was based on overhang angle, it is percentage instead (which makes much more sense for different layer heights). My 10-25% overhang speed wasn't set to slow down and that must translate to about 35° at 0.2mm layer height. I now have it set to 30mm/s and it now looks great 👍 And sorry, I was wrong when I stated the overhang speed 😅
